AI language can appear in security hiring without materially changing the underlying responsibilities, controls, or operating model.
The market asks for AI security engineering skills before it has standardized, practical evaluation pathways to validate them.
AI security hiring often compresses responsibilities historically distributed across several security disciplines into one requisition.
What companies really mean by AI Security Engineer and why the operating model is lagging the technology.
The market prices one role while frequently describing team-level capability breadth, compressing five or more specialties into a single requisition.
Some organizations are too small to hire the unicorn role the market has priced, but too exposed to defer AI security entirely.
